Liven up old thread about this character...

I think he's a pretty versatile character that fits most of team builds. His perfect hit passive makes him autogrind machine, and his high ATK stat means he's a great single-attacker, and his basic skill has a chance to critically strike (double the damage, probably? Not sure the calculation)

Paired with Angel of Fear and multiple-enemy attacker Eddie, you can beat most wave of enemies in 1 turn.
Paired with anyone with Freeze, Blind, Stun talisman and AoE damage (assuming most of this kind is magus or sentinel characters), you can trigger the effect easily even on autogrind.
Paired with Nomad/Wickerman/Allied General (ATK buff passive), you can get his basic skill damage up to 10-11k (non-crit) to a neutral enemy. Anyone with physical charge will works, too.

Maxed stats:
HP 7000
ATK 1757
DEF 628
MAG 532
MR 628
SP 466

Basic attack scales with SP and ATK so I'd say go with Rush/Warp (Will) talismans on the yellow slots, Strength (Fierce/Safeguard) on the Red and 1 Meta, and the other 2 Meta slots are your choice - either 2 more red, 2 more yellow or some HP - go wild! :)

Also, yes - this guy's a top defender because of this passive.
